Transaction 64459d75ac861bac00e2f749cde4d3b91f7f6d940e3843164f58cfb36fc31e81

1 Input
2 Outputs
  • 64459d75ac861bac00e2f749cde4d3b91f7f6d940e3843164f58cfb36fc31e81:0
  • value  19958860
    address  1EidaDNEyRZbzSohrAc41tkrgKgRcesukd
  • 64459d75ac861bac00e2f749cde4d3b91f7f6d940e3843164f58cfb36fc31e81:1
  • value  20000000
    address  1329FLHsCuxGdas5v51dciRzpCaRV7BSYN